Andrew York (b. 1958) is a Grammy-winning American guitarist and composer known for blending classical technique with folk, jazz, and world music influences. Home , subtitled A Celtic Hymn , appears on his 2004 album The Equations of Beauty . The piece is written in DADGAD tuning (low to high: D A D G A D), a tuning commonly associated with Celtic and folk guitar.
